The Best of Both Worlds

By: Suzanne Stephens
Friday, May 25, 2007 8:02 AM

As a designer, I've used and loved Macs for years but because I do Web site design, I have to also have a PC to cross-platform check sites and to work on Point2Agent sites. With my PC laptop on a steady decline ever since the cat knocked it off the desk, I recently bought an Intel Mini Mac. A couple of weeks ago I installed Parallels and Windows on my Mac. I'm amazed at how easy they were to set up and at what a great solution this has been for my work. I especially like being able to create, edit and upload graphics to Point2Agent sites without having to move them from one computer to the other.

Literally the only problem I have is remembering to Command Copy in the Mac OS, then Control Paste in Windows. It was easier for me to use the correct keyboard commands when working exclusively in one environment or the other, but copying and pasting back and forth between the two OS's on the same keyboard and monitor is trickier. In fact, simply grasping the notion that I can do that has been challenging!

The most fun part of this experience was seeing my husband's doubletake the first time he walked by desk and noticed the Windows screen saver running on my Mac monitor!

If you're a dedicated Mac head like me but forced to used a PC for your real estate work, I highly recommend this awesome solution.

Gregory, thanks for your comments about GoArmyHomes.com. I should explain that because it is a new site (just published in February 2007), it actually does not get high search engine ranking.

Most traffic to the site comes from banner ads that I created to match the site's branding. Broker Linda Jefferson gets good traffic by running her banner ads on a very highly ranked  local site listing real estate and rental companies.

Her site does, however, benefits from being so emotionally engaging that Linda gets several phone calls every day from military families all over the world who are being redeployed to Fort Sill.

After taking a class with Michael Russer, Linda was very nervous at first about switching from her general focus Jefferson Bentley web site to her niche targeted site, but it has been a huge success. Her office went from 0 deals in-house to 11 within two weeks of the site's launch and a high-volume agent had recruited himself to switch to her office. The last time I talked with her, her office had around 25-30 deals underway, including her first luxury home listing. To a large extent, her new success is a result of her passion for supporting her local troops. Linda is a very inspiring person.
